Value Proposition

What is a Value Proposition?


 refers to the value a company promises to deliver to
customers should they choose to buy their product.

 is part of a company's overall marketing strategy.

 provides a declaration of intent or a statement that


introduces a company's brand to consumers by telling them
what the company stands for, how it operates, and why it
deserves their business.
What is a Value Proposition?

 A value proposition is a brief statement in which a


business explains to potential customers how a
business is unique, what it offers to target customers,
and how it can improve their lives. Usually, the value
proposition is between two to five sentences long.
Value propositions are often featured in a business’s
website, products, and marketing campaigns. They are
a critical part of any business’s brand strategy.
Components of a Value Proposition
A successful value proposition typically has a strong, clear
headline that communicates the delivered benefit to the
consumer. The headline should be a single memorable
sentence, phrase, or even a tagline. It frequently incorporates
catchy slogans that become part of successful advertising
campaigns

Often a subheadline will be provided underneath the main


headline, expanding on the explanation of the delivered
value and giving a specific example of why the product or
service is superior to others the consumer has in mind.

Value Proposition Canvas
 The Value Proposition Canvas focuses on understanding customers’
problems and producing products or services that solve them.

 Telling people you have a great product doesn’t make them want it.

 You can produce an awesome product with all the bells and whistles,
but if it fundamentally doesn’t help customers, or you don’t explain the
value clearly, they won’t buy it.
Value Proposition Canvas is critical to a
business model. It helps the business in
decision making and positioning of the
product. It is more than just a graphical
representation of customer wants.
Businesses can align their strategies
according to customer needs. This can
help to produce a product which
customers want.
